• 제목/요약/키워드: Random Generator

검색결과 282건 처리시간 0.023초

지능망에서 서비스 제어 로직의 호 분배 서비스 특성을 위한 방법 (Methods for Call Distribution Service Feature of Service Control Logic in Intelligent Network)

  • Tae-Gyu Kang;Su-Ki Paik
    • 인터넷정보학회논문지
    • /
    • 제2권4호
    • /
    • pp.1-10
    • /
    • 2001
  • 본 논문에서는 지능망에서 서비스 제어 로직의 호 분배 서비스 특징에 대한 요구사항을 정의한다. 또한. 각 가입자마다 지정한 호 분배률에 따라 호 분배할 수 있도록 호 분배 메커니즘을 제안한다. 호 분배 메커니즘은 지능망에서 정보료 수납대행 서비스에서 발전되었다. 본 논문에서의 호 분배 메커니즘은 순환 분배 또는 계층 분배 방식이 아닌 퍼센티지 분배 방식을 채택하였다. 호 분배 메커니즘은 호 입력, 출력, 호 분배 처리 로직 부, 랜덤넘버 생성기 가입자 데이터베이스 등으로 구성된다. 본 논문에서는 호 분배 메커니즘을 위한 실제적인 구현 알고리즘을 제시하고. 이를 위한 호 분배 결정 지시 산출 방법을 제안하였다. 호 분배 결정 지시 산출 방법에는 C 언어에서 제공하는 rand( ) 함수, 시스템 클럭, 제안된 알고리즘 등이 있다. 최적의 호 분배 메커니즘을 위하여, 3가지 방법에 대한 발생 패턴. 발생 수 등을 측정하여 평가하였다.

  • PDF

광선추적법 기반의 적분구 분석 시뮬레이터에서 OpenMP 지시어를 이용한 속도 향상 및 몬테카를로 방법의 무작위성 보장 (Improving the Calculation Speed of Ray-tracing Based Simulator for Analyzing an Integrating Sphere with OpenMP Directive and Guaranteeing the Randomness of Monte Carlo Method)

  • 김승용;김대찬;오범환;박세근;이일항;이승걸
    • 한국광학회지
    • /
    • 제22권2호
    • /
    • pp.83-89
    • /
    • 2011
  • 광선추적법을 기반으로 하는 적분구 분석 시뮬레이터의 계산속도를 향상하기 위하여 OpenMP 지시어를 이용한 병렬처리 방식의 시뮬레이터를 개발하였으며, 몬테카를로 방법의 무작위성을 보장하기 위해 병렬 난수 발생기인 RngStream 패키지를 활용하였다. $10^7$개 이상의 광선 수를 사용하여 0.5%의 오차 범위에서 적분구 이론식과 일치하는 결과를 얻을 수 있었으며, 스레드 수에 따른 계산속도 향상 효과를 확인하였다. 또한 적분구 문제에 관한 공간반응분포함수(spatial response distribution function)을 전산모사하여, 기존 문헌의 결과와 일치함을 확인하였다.

난수생성기를 이용한 멀티채널 보안카드 설계 (A Multi-Channel Security Card based on Cryptographically Secure Pseudo-Random Number Generator)

  • 서화정;석선희;김경훈;김호원
    • 정보보호학회논문지
    • /
    • 제25권3호
    • /
    • pp.501-507
    • /
    • 2015
  • 온라인 뱅킹 서비스는 금전과 관련된 업무를 처리함으로 정보교환에 있어서 안전한 보안이 제공되어야 한다. 현재 안전한 전자 금융 거래 서비스를 위해 공인인증서와 비밀번호, 보안카드, 일회용 비밀번호생성기(OTP) 와 같이 여러 가지 사용자 인증 방법이 존재한다. 특히 보안카드는 금융거래를 진행함에 있어서 모든 비밀정보를 포함하는 가장 중요한 비밀 매체이고 한 번 노출이 되고 나면 보안카드로써의 기능을 상실할 뿐 아니라 공격자는 획득하기 가장 어려운 비밀정보를 가지게 되므로 보다 높은 확률로 공격을 성공할 수 있다. 본 논문에서는 물리적인 보안카드가 가지는 비밀정보를 다른 채널에 분할하여 저장하는 기법을 통해 정보 유출의 위험성을 줄이는 방안을 제시한다. 제안하는 멀티채널 보안카드는 표시되는 비밀 정보의 양을 줄이고, 동적으로 생성하는 방법을 이용하여 비밀 정보 노출의 취약성을 줄이고 피싱 공격을 예방하는 기능을 가진다.

ELF 전자파 피폭 세포실험을 위한 배양기의 전류밀도 분포 해석 및 In Vitro 노출장치 설계 (Analysis of Current Density Distribution and In Vitro Exposur System fot ELF Exposed Cell Experiments)

  • 김대근;정재승;안재목
    • 한국전자파학회논문지
    • /
    • 제12권1호
    • /
    • pp.84-91
    • /
    • 2001
  • ELF 전자파의 생물학적인 영향 평가를 위한 in vitro 세포실험에서 노출장치의 설게는 코일내의 유도기전력(E)과 전류밀도 (J) 해석과 함께 이루어져야 한다. 균일 자기장 속에서 세포응 배양할 경우에도 배양기내의 전도성 매질오 인해 균일한 E와 J가 분포하지않는다. 따라서 균일한 ELF 자기장 노출장치로부터 발생되는 샘플 매질 내에서 E와 j를 정확히 예측하는 것은 in vitro 세포실험의 성공여부를 가늠할 정도로 매우 중요한 정보가 된다. 이에 본 논문에서는 in vitro 실험에 접합한 ELF in vitro 노출장치를 설계하고 노출장치에 대한 전자기학적 평가를 수행하였다. 코일 내에서 샘플 매질의 유무와 샘플 내에서도 세포가 놓여질 임의의 위치에 따라 E와 J를 예측하고 검증을 위한 측정과 시뮬레이션을 시도하였다. 노출장치는 헬름 홀쯔 코일로 제작되었고 자기장의 세기는 1-20G 범위 내에서 가변이 가능하다. 또한 코일내의 자기장의 분포가 균일(uniform), 비균일(non-uniform)한 두 가지 모드를 각각 제작하여 보였다.

  • PDF

암호장치의 송·수신자 역할 설정이 없는 양자키분배 시스템 설계 (Design of Quantum Key Distribution System without Fixed Role of Cryptographic Applications)

  • 고행석;지세완;장진각
    • 정보보호학회논문지
    • /
    • 제30권5호
    • /
    • pp.771-780
    • /
    • 2020
  • 양자키분배(QKD)는 양자컴퓨터의 위협으로부터 안전하게 비밀키를 나누어 갖는 키공유 프로토콜 중 하나이다. 일반적으로 QKD 장치에 연결되는 암호장치는 경합조건 발생과 구현의 복잡성 때문에 송신자 또는 수신자의 역할을 설치할 때부터 적용한다. 기존 QKD 시스템은 링크용 암호장치에 주로 적용되었기 때문에 암호장치의 송·수신자 역할을 고정하여도 문제가 없었다. 암호장치와 QKD 장치가 공급하는 양자키의 종속성을 제거하여, QKD 네트워크로 유연하게 확장할 수 있는 새로운 QKD 시스템 및 프로토콜을 제안하였다. 기존 QKD 시스템에서는 암호장치가 요청하는 비밀키를 양자키로 직접 분배하였으나, 제안한 QKD 시스템에서는 난수로 생성한 비밀키를 암호장치에 분배한다. 두 QKD 노드 사이에서 미리 나누어 가진 송신용 및 수신용 양자키를 이용하여 비밀키를 암호화하고 전달하는 구조를 제안하였다. 제안한 QKD 시스템은 QKD 장치들 사이에서 공유한 양자키의 의존성을 제거하여 암호장치의 고정된 송·수신자 역할이 필요 없다.

오류 역전도 알고리즘의 학습속도 향상기법 (An Enhancement of Learning Speed of the Error - Backpropagation Algorithm)

  • 심범식;정의용;윤충화;강경식
    • 한국정보처리학회논문지
    • /
    • 제4권7호
    • /
    • pp.1759-1769
    • /
    • 1997
  • 다층신경회로망의 학습방법인 오류역전도 알고리즘은 연관기억장치, 음성인식, 패턴인식, 로보틱스등과 같은 다양한 응용분야에 널리 사용되고 있다. 그럼에도 불구하고 계속 많은 논문들이 역전도 알고리즘에 대해 발표되고 있는 실정이다. 이러한 연구 동향의 주된 이유는, 뉴런 갯수와 학습 패턴의 갯수가 큰 경우에 역전도 알고리즘의 학습속도가 상당히 느리다는 사실때문이다. 본 연구에서는 가변학습율, 가변모멘텀율, 그리고 시그모이드 함수의 가변기울기를 이용한 새로운 학습속도 가속기법을 개발하였다. 학습이 수행되는 도중에, 이러한 파라메터들은 전체 오류의 변화량에 따라 연속적으로 조정되며, 제안된 기법은 기존의 역전도 알고리즘에 비해 획기적으로 학습시간을 단축시키는 결과를 보였다. 제안된 기법의 효율성을 입증하기 위하여, 처음에는 난수발생기로 생성한 이진 데이터를 이용하여 에포크(epoch) 횟수를 비교할 때 훌륭한 속도 향상을 보였으며, 또한, 기계학습(machine learning)의 벤치마크 학습자료로 많이 사용되는 이진 Monk's data, 4, 5, 6, 7비트 패리티 검사 문제와 실수 Iris data에도 적용하였다.

  • PDF

ECC 기반의 공개키 보안 프로토콜을 지원하는 보안 SoC (A Security SoC supporting ECC based Public-Key Security Protocols)

  • 김동성;신경욱
    • 한국정보통신학회논문지
    • /
    • 제24권11호
    • /
    • pp.1470-1476
    • /
    • 2020
  • 모바일 장치와 IoT의 보안 프로토콜 구현에 적합한 경량 보안 SoC 설계에 대해 기술한다. Cortex-M0을 CPU로 사용하는 보안 SoC에는 타원곡선 암호 (elliptic curve cryptography) 코어, SHA3 해시 코어, ARIA-AES 블록 암호 코어 및 무작위 난수 생성기 (TRNG) 코어 등의 하드웨어 크립토 엔진들이 내장되어 있다. 핵심 연산장치인 ECC 코어는 SEC2에 정의된 20개의 소수체와 이진체 타원곡선을 지원하며, 부분곱 생성 및 가산 연산과 모듈러 축약 연산이 서브 파이프라인 방식으로 동작하는 워드 기반 몽고메리 곱셈기를 기반으로 설계되었다. 보안 SoC를 Cyclone-5 FPGA 디바이스에 구현하고 타원곡선 디지털 서명 프로토콜의 H/W-S/W 통합 검증을 하였다. 65-nm CMOS 셀 라이브러리로 합성된 보안 SoC는 193,312 등가 게이트와 84 kbyte의 메모리로 구현되었다.

Development and validation of prediction equations for the assessment of muscle or fat mass using anthropometric measurements, serum creatinine level, and lifestyle factors among Korean adults

  • Lee, Gyeongsil;Chang, Jooyoung;Hwang, Seung-sik;Son, Joung Sik;Park, Sang Min
    • Nutrition Research and Practice
    • /
    • 제15권1호
    • /
    • pp.95-105
    • /
    • 2021
  • BACKGROUND/OBJECTIVES: The measurement of body composition, including muscle and fat mass, remains challenging in large epidemiological studies due to time constraint and cost when using accurate modalities. Therefore, this study aimed to develop and validate prediction equations according to sex to measure lean body mass (LBM), appendicular skeletal muscle mass (ASM), and body fat mass (BFM) using anthropometric measurement, serum creatinine level, and lifestyle factors as independent variables and dual-energy X-ray absorptiometry as the reference method. SUBJECTS/METHODS: A sample of the Korean general adult population (men: 7,599; women: 10,009) from the Korean National Health and Nutrition Examination Survey 2008-2011 was included in this study. The participants were divided into the derivation and validation groups via a random number generator (with a ratio of 70:30). The prediction equations were developed using a series of multivariable linear regressions and validated using the Bland-Altman plot and intraclass correlation coefficient (ICC). RESULTS: The initial and practical equations that included age, height, weight, and waist circumference had a different predictive ability for LBM (men: R2 = 0.85, standard error of estimate [SEE] = 2.7 kg; women: R2 = 0.78, SEE = 2.2 kg), ASM (men: R2 = 0.81, SEE = 1.6 kg; women: R2 = 0.71, SEE = 1.2 kg), and BFM (men: R2 = 0.74, SEE = 2.7 kg; women: R2 = 0.83, SEE = 2.2 kg) according to sex. Compared with the first prediction equation, the addition of other factors, including serum creatinine level, physical activity, smoking status, and alcohol use, resulted in an R2 that is higher by 0.01 and SEE that is lower by 0.1. CONCLUSIONS: All equations had low bias, moderate agreement based on the Bland-Altman plot, and high ICC, and this result showed that these equations can be further applied to other epidemiologic studies.

GF(q)상의 원시다항식 생성에 관한 연구 (On algorithm for finding primitive polynomials over GF(q))

  • 최희봉;원동호
    • 정보보호학회논문지
    • /
    • 제11권1호
    • /
    • pp.35-42
    • /
    • 2001
  • GF(q)상의 원시다항식은 스크램블러, 에러정정 부호 및 복호기, 난수 발생기 그리고 스트림 암호기 등 여러 분야에 걸쳐 많이 사용되고 있다. GF(q)상의 원시다항식을 생성하는 효율적인 알고리즘이 A.D. Porto에 의하여 제안되었으며, 그 알고리즘은 한 원시다항식을 이용하여 다른 원시다항식을 구하는 방법을 반복 사용하여 원시다항식 수열을 생성하는 방법이다. 이 논문에서는 A.D. Porto가 제안한 알고리즘을 개선한 알고리즘을 제안하였다. A.D. Porto의 알고리즘의 running time은 O($\textrm{km}^2$)이고, 개선된 알고리즘 running time은 O(w(m+k))이다. 여기서 k는 gcd(k,$q^m$-1)이 다. m차 원시다항식을 구하고자 할 때 k, m>>1 조건에서는 개선된 알고리즘을 사용하는 것이 효율적이다.

RC4 스트림 암호 알고리즘을 위한 고속 연산 구조의 FPGA 구현 및 성능 분석 (FPGA Implementation and Performance Analysis of High Speed Architecture for RC4 Stream Cipher Algorithm)

  • 최병윤;이종형;조현숙
    • 정보보호학회논문지
    • /
    • 제14권4호
    • /
    • pp.123-134
    • /
    • 2004
  • 본 논문에서는 RC4 스트림 암호 알고리즘을 구현하는 고속 연산 구조를 제안하고, FPGA 구현 결과를 제시하였다. 기존 방식이 긴 초기화 동작이 필요하거나, S-배열 초기화 대기 시간을 제거하기 위해 S-배열을 2개 혹은 3개를 사용하는 구조를 갖는데 비해, 제안한 RC4 스트림 암호 연산 구조는 256-비트 valid-비트 엔트리 방식을 사용하여, S-배열 초기화 동작을 제거하였다. 그리고 RC4 알고리즘을 다양한 응용 분야에 사용될 수 있도록 효율적인 모듈라 연산 하드웨어를 사용하여 40 비트와 128 비트 키를 지원하도록 하였다. 제안한 RC4 스트림 암호 연산 구조를 Xilinx XCV1000E-6H240C FPGA로 구현하였다. 설계된 RC4 프로세서는 40MHz에서 106Mbps의 암호 비트 생성율의 성능을 갖고 있으며 WEP 프로세서와 RC4 키 검색 엔진에 적용 가능하다.